Transaction 0536bc3dfb16ef3915055bc707c3f257554d18d19a9bb76e38df69f7d1e8a6d8
1 Input
1 Outputs
- 0536bc3dfb16ef3915055bc707c3f257554d18d19a9bb76e38df69f7d1e8a6d8:0
value 2673743
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G